About This Item

New York: G. P. Putnam's Sons. Very Good+ in Very Good dust jacket. 1981. First Edition. Hardcover. 0399126732 . DJ and boards show light shelf wear, short closed tear top of DJ. Previous owner's name embossed on FFEP. ; A bright, solid book, dustjacket in Mylar, unclipped.; 8vo 8" - 9" tall; 293 pages; "Ramstan, captain of the al-Buraq, a rare model spaceship capable of instantaneous travel between two points, attempts to stop an unidentified "creature" that is annihilating intelligent life on planets throughout the universe" .

About Ainsworth Books

Ainsworth Books was for many years a bricks and mortar store in Vancouver, BC. When we acquired the store, we moved to a location in Delta. After three years we moved the stock home and started operation as an online, by appointment only operation. I have worked with books my whole adult life and enjoy giving recommendations.
